MySQL教程:跨平台初始化设置与命令行操作详解

需积分: 1 0 下载量 177 浏览量 更新于2024-08-03 收藏 327KB PDF 举报
本教程是关于MySQL的基础设置指南,主要针对MySQL在不同操作系统上的初始化配置和管理。在讲解如何在MacOS、Linux和Windows环境下安装和初始化MySQL时,特别强调了命令行工具的使用,因为这对于理解数据库服务的底层运作至关重要。 在MacOS中,尽管官方不推荐直接使用`mysql.server`命令,但它是早期版本的便捷方式。如果找不到这个全局命令,用户可以在MySQL安装目录下的`support-files`子目录找到`mysql.serverstart`命令进行操作。为了确保服务状态,用户可以运行`mysql.server status`或使用`systemctl status mysqld.service`,同时,如果遇到启动失败的情况,可以利用`systemctl`和`journalctl`命令来检查和解决问题。 相比之下,Linux环境下的服务管理更加标准。在基于systemd的Linux系统中,用户可以直接使用`systemctl`来启动、停止、重启MySQL服务,比如: - 启动:`systemctl start mysqld` - 停止:`systemctl stop mysqld` - 重启:`systemctl restart mysqld` - 查看状态:`systemctl status mysqld.service` `servicemysqldstart` 和 `mysqldstart` 也是常用的启动选项,而 `mysqldstop` 和 `mysql.serverstop` 则用于停止服务。同样,如果服务状态有误,通过上述命令结合`journalctl`来排查问题。 对于Windows用户,虽然没有提及具体的命令行步骤,但通常情况下,MySQL的安装包会提供图形化界面供用户管理和配置,包括启动、停止和重启服务。不过,熟悉命令行操作有助于在遇到问题时能快速定位和解决。 本教程为初学者和管理员提供了一个实用的指南,帮助他们了解在不同操作系统上正确地安装、初始化和管理MySQL服务,确保数据库的稳定运行。无论是通过图形化界面还是命令行,掌握这些基础操作都是成为一名高效MySQL用户的基石。